In the eagerly anticipated Coupe de France semi-final showdown set for April 3, 2024, Paris Saint-Germain (PSG) is poised to host Rennes at the iconic Parc des Princes.

As PSG eyes their 15th Coupe de France trophy, the stakes couldn't be higher in this thrilling encounter.

PSG Predicted XI

Key Players

Kylian Mbappe: The forward is leading the Coupe de France's Golden Boot race and is set for a pivotal role in PSG's quest for silverware.

 

Goncalo Ramos and Vitinha: The Portuguese duo were instrumental in PSG's recent win against Marseille, highlighting their critical importance to the team's offensive dynamics.

Full Predicted Lineup: Gianluigi Donnarumma, Achraf Hakimi, Danilo Pereira, Lucas Beraldo, Theo Hernandez, Warren Zaire-Emery, Vitinha, Fabian Ruiz, Ousmane Dembele, Kylian Mbappe, Randal Kolo Muani.

Rennes Predicted XI

Key Players

Arnaud Kalimuendo-Muinga: Rennes' leading scorer is expected to return to the starting lineup, providing a much-needed boost to the team's attacking options.

Benjamin Bourigeaud and Martin Terrier: Both players have been key components of Rennes' journey to the semi-finals and will be crucial for any chance of an upset.

 

Full Lineup: Steve Mandanda, Desire Doue, Loic Bade, Arthur Theate, Warmed Omari, Lesley Ugochukwu, Baptiste Santamaria, Benjamin Bourigeaud, Amine Gouiri, Martin Terrier, Arnaud Kalimuendo-Muinga.
